ibis-cover-300x250IBIS continuously publishes research articles online as:

  • Accepted articles (peer-reviewed awaiting final edit and layout, DOI assigned);
  • Early view articles (first sight of fully edited publication); and
  • Within issue articles (article assigned to an issue with page numbers).
